从0开始centos系统利用tomcat部署springmvc项目

配置JDK

下载jdk
链接:https://pan.baidu.com/s/1Bad7lp1HBIS6w23o9jmWIQ
提取码:4f2v
创建文件夹

mkdir -p /usr/java

上传文件到/home 目录下解压

tar -zxf jdk-8u161-linux-x64.tar.gz

移动目录

mv /home/jdk1.8.0_161/ /usr/java/

修改环境变量

vim  /etc/profile

文件最下边加上

export JAVA_HOME=/usr/java/jdk1.8.0_161
export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$PATH:$JAVA_HOME/bin

刷新使之生效

source /etc/profile 

查看jdk配置信息

java -version

配置tomcat

下载
https://dlcdn.apache.org/tomcat/tomcat-9/v9.0.60/bin/apache-tomcat-9.0.60.tar.gz

创建tomcat 目录

mkdir -p /wwww/tomcat

上传文件到/home 目录下解压

tar -zxf tar -zxf apache-tomcat-9.0.60.tar.gz

重命名,移动

mv apache-tomcat-9.0.60 tomcat9
mv tomcat9/ /www/tomcat/

配置tomcat自启

cd /usr/lib/systemd/system
vi tomcat9.service
[Unit]

Description=Tomcat

After=syslog.target network.target remote-fs.target nss-lookup.target

[Service]

Type=oneshot

ExecStart=/www//tomcat/tomcat9/bin/startup.sh
ExecStop=/www//tomcat/tomcat9/bin/shutdown.sh
ExecReload=/bin/kill -s HUP $MAINPID
RemainAfterExit=yes

[Install]

WantedBy=multi-user.target

设置自启

systemctl enable tomcat9.service

放行端口

firewall-cmd --zone=public --add-port=8080/tcp --permanent
firewall-cmd --reload

启动失败 修改setclasspath.sh

vi /www/tomcat/tomcat9/bin/setclasspath.sh

添加java路径

export JAVA_HOME=/usr/java/jdk1.8.0_161
export JRE_HOME=/usr/java/jdk1.8.0_161/jre

删除webapps目录下多余文件,上传war包到webapps目录下启动tomcat

systemctl start tomcat9.service

访问地址
http://ip:8080/项目名

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值